Ошибки загрузки dll файла могут возникать при запуске программы или при выполнении определенного действия. Данная ошибка связана с невозможностью загрузки требуемой динамической библиотеки, которая необходима для работы программы.
Далее в статье рассмотрены основные причины возникновения данной ошибки, а также предложены различные методы ее решения. Вам будут представлены практические рекомендации по исправлению ошибок загрузки dll файлов, которые помогут вам быстро и эффективно решить данный проблему.
Что такое DLL файлы
DLL (англ. Dynamic Link Library) – это исполняемый файл, содержащий код и данные, которые могут быть использованы несколькими приложениями одновременно. DLL файлы являются одним из основных компонентов операционных систем Windows.
Основная особенность DLL файлов заключается в том, что они представляют собой набор функций и ресурсов, которые могут быть вызваны из других программ. Это позволяет приложениям использовать общий код, вместо его дублирования в каждом приложении.
Структура DLL файла
DLL файлы могут содержать различные типы данных и ресурсов, таких как функции, переменные, константы, данные, иконки, битмапы и т. д. Они могут быть написаны на разных языках программирования, таких как C, C++, C#, Delphi и других.
Использование DLL файлов
DLL файлы используются для предоставления компонентов, которые могут быть использованы различными приложениями. Они могут содержать готовые функции или классы, которые облегчают разработку программ и позволяют повторно использовать код.
Приложения могут загружать DLL файлы в свою память и вызывать их функции или использовать их ресурсы. DLL файлы могут быть загружены при старте приложения или во время его работы.
Ошибка загрузки DLL файла
Ошибка загрузки DLL файла может возникнуть, если файл отсутствует, поврежден или не соответствует ожидаемой версии. Ошибка может быть вызвана также несовместимостью кода DLL файла с текущей версией операционной системы или другими компонентами программы.
Для иборьбы ошибок загрузки DLL файлов рекомендуется проверить, находится ли файл по указанному пути, обновить операционную систему и убедиться в совместимости версии DLL файла с программой, которая его использует.
Отсутствия DLL в Windows: Решение проблем с библиотеками динамической загрузки
Причины возникновения ошибки загрузки dll файла
Ошибка загрузки dll файла может возникать по разным причинам. DLL (Dynamic Link Library) — это набор функций и процедур, которые используются программами для общения друг с другом и повторного использования кода. Когда программа нуждается в выполнении определенной функции, она загружает соответствующую DLL и вызывает нужную функцию из нее. Ошибка загрузки DLL может означать, что программа не может найти или загрузить нужный DLL файл для выполнения требуемой функции.
Отсутствующий DLL файл
Одна из основных причин ошибки загрузки dll файла — отсутствие самого файла. Это может произойти, если DLL файл был удален или перемещен, или если он был неправильно установлен или обновлен. Если программа не может найти требуемый DLL файл на своем месте, она не сможет загрузить его и вызвать нужную функцию.
Несовместимая версия DLL файла
Еще одна причина ошибки загрузки dll файла — несовместимость версии DLL с программой, которая его вызывает. Если программа требует конкретную версию DLL файла, а на компьютере установлена другая версия, возникнет ошибка загрузки. Также, если DLL файл был обновлен, но программа все еще использует старую версию, это может вызвать ошибку загрузки.
Поврежденный DLL файл
Иногда DLL файл может быть поврежден или испорчен, что приведет к ошибке загрузки. Это может произойти, если файл был неправильно загружен или установлен, или если он был поврежден в процессе работы программы или хранения на диске. Если DLL файл поврежден, программе будет сложно или невозможно загрузить его и вызвать нужные функции.
Проблемы с зависимостями
Еще одна распространенная причина ошибки загрузки dll файла — проблемы с зависимостями. DLL файлы могут быть зависимыми от других DLL файлов или дополнительных ресурсов, например, конфигурационных файлов или библиотек. Если эти зависимости отсутствуют или несовместимы, программа не сможет загрузить нужный DLL файл и вызвать нужные функции.
Отсутствие прав доступа
Иногда ошибка загрузки dll файла может быть вызвана отсутствием необходимых прав доступа. Некоторые DLL файлы могут требовать административных или специальных прав для доступа и использования. Если у пользователя нет таких прав, программа может не иметь возможности загрузить DLL файл и вызвать нужные функции.
Возможные последствия ошибки загрузки dll файла
Ошибки загрузки dll файла могут иметь различные последствия для работы программы или системы в целом. В данной статье мы рассмотрим несколько наиболее распространенных проблем, которые могут возникнуть при возникновении такой ошибки.
1. Невозможность запуска программы
Один из наиболее очевидных последствий ошибки загрузки dll файла — это невозможность запуска программы, которая зависит от данного файла. Для работы программы необходимы все необходимые библиотеки, и если одна из них отсутствует или загружена неправильно, то программа не сможет запуститься. Это может быть особенно проблематично, если это критическая программа, которая используется в работе или влияет на другие системные компоненты.
2. Нестабильная работа программы
Если при загрузке dll файла возникла ошибка, то программа, использующая этот файл, может работать нестабильно. Это может проявляться в виде сбоев, зависаний, непредсказуемого поведения и других проблем. Нередко такие ошибки загрузки dll файлов приводят к непредсказуемому поведению программы, что затрудняет ее использование и может вызывать потерю данных.
3. Проблемы с безопасностью
Ошибка загрузки dll файла также может привести к проблемам с безопасностью компьютерной системы. Если злоумышленники смогут скомпрометировать или подменить dll файл, то они могут получить доступ к системе или программе и использовать его для своих злонамеренных целей. Это может привести к утечке конфиденциальной информации, выполнению вредоносного кода и другим серьезным последствиям.
Важно отметить, что ошибки загрузки dll файлов могут быть вызваны различными причинами, включая повреждение файла, удаление или перемещение файла, отсутствие нужной версии файла и другие. Поэтому в случае возникновения такой ошибки рекомендуется обратиться к специалистам или воспользоваться специальными инструментами для иборьбы проблемы.
Как исправить ошибку загрузки dll файла
Ошибка загрузки DLL файла может возникнуть при запуске программы, когда система не может найти или загрузить необходимую библиотеку DLL. Эта ошибка может возникнуть по разным причинам, но существуют несколько шагов, которые могут помочь исправить это проблему.
1. Перезагрузить компьютер
Перезагрузка компьютера может помочь исправить некоторые временные проблемы, возникающие при загрузке DLL. Попробуйте перезагрузить компьютер и запустить программу еще раз.
2. Проверить наличие библиотеки DLL
Убедитесь, что файл DLL, который требуется для работы программы, существует на вашем компьютере. Проверьте, находится ли файл DLL в правильной директории. Если файл отсутствует или находится в неправильном месте, вам необходимо восстановить или переместить его в правильное место.
3. Переустановить программу
Попробуйте переустановить программу, которая вызывает ошибку загрузки DLL файла. В некоторых случаях, переустановка программы может помочь восстановить недостающую или поврежденную DLL библиотеку.
4. Обновить драйверы
Устаревшие или поврежденные драйверы могут вызывать ошибки загрузки DLL файлов. Проверьте, есть ли доступные обновления для драйверов вашей системы. Вы можете посетить веб-сайты производителей оборудования или использовать программное обеспечение для обновления драйверов.
5. Проверить наличие вирусов
Некоторые вредоносные программы могут повредить или удалить файлы DLL, что приведет к ошибкам загрузки. Убедитесь, что ваша система защищена от вредоносных программ, с помощью антивирусного программного обеспечения. Прогоните проверку на наличие вирусов и удалите любые обнаруженные угрозы.
6. Восстановить систему
Если все вышеперечисленные методы не помогают исправить ошибку загрузки DLL файла, попробуйте восстановить систему до предыдущего рабочего состояния. Восстановление системы может вернуть вашу систему к предыдущему состоянию, когда ошибка загрузки DLL файла еще не возникала.
Исправление ошибки загрузки DLL файла может потребовать несколько попыток и разных подходов. Если вы не уверены, что делать, рекомендуется обратиться к технической поддержке или специалистам, которые могут помочь решить эту проблему.
Меры предосторожности для предотвращения ошибки загрузки dll файла
Ошибка загрузки dll файла может возникнуть при попытке запуска программы или игры, которая требует наличие определенной библиотеки. Для предотвращения этой ошибки и обеспечения бесперебойной работы программы необходимо принять следующие меры предосторожности:
Обновление операционной системы и программ
Чтобы избежать проблем с загрузкой dll файлов, рекомендуется регулярно обновлять операционную систему и устанавливать все доступные обновления для установленных программ. Это позволит исправить возможные ошибки и обновить драйверы, которые необходимы для работы с dll файлами.
Загрузка dll файлов из официальных источников
При необходимости загрузки dll файлов, важно выбирать надежные источники. Лучше всего скачивать dll файлы с официальных сайтов разработчиков программы или из проверенных репозиториев. Это поможет избежать загрузки вредоносных файлов или версий библиотек, которые несовместимы с вашей системой.
Установка и обновление антивирусного программного обеспечения
Чтобы защитить компьютер от вредоносных программ, в том числе от загрузки вредоносных dll файлов, рекомендуется установить и регулярно обновлять антивирусное программное обеспечение. Это поможет обнаружить и удалить потенциально опасные файлы, прежде чем они причинят вред системе.
Не удаление dll файлов без необходимости
Не рекомендуется удалять dll файлы без необходимости, так как они могут быть необходимы для работы определенных программ. Если вы не уверены, нужен ли вам какой-то конкретный dll файл, лучше оставить его в системе. Часто проблема загрузки dll файлов связана с их отсутствием или повреждением, поэтому удаление может только ухудшить ситуацию.
Создание резервных копий системы и важных файлов
Для защиты от ошибки загрузки dll файлов и других проблем с системой, рекомендуется создавать регулярные резервные копии системы и важных файлов. Это позволит быстро восстановить систему в случае сбоя или ошибки. Сохранение копии dll файлов также может быть полезно, если вам потребуется восстановить конкретную библиотеку.
Соблюдение данных мер предосторожности поможет предотвратить ошибку загрузки dll файлов и обеспечить бесперебойную работу программ и игр на вашем компьютере.